I need to do a compression check on my engine to find out why I am burning/blowing out excessive oil.

I was told to do a differential compression check, I was reading the M14P maintenance manual and Task Card 248 "Check Of Cylinder Compression" instructs you to check compression with a pressure gauge.

My question is, Is one way better than the other?

I am referring to M14PF-XDK on a YAK 52TW

If the manual you reference does not provide specific parameters to check the compression with a pressure gauge, then my suggestion would be to use the industry accepted differential compression test.
